WebJan 24, 2024 · The difference between a first-party cookie and a third-party cookie comes down to which domain the cookie comes from. A first-party cookie comes from whichever domain you’re currently browsing. For example, if you are on ethoseo.com (surprise – you are!), the domain for a first-party cookie would be set to something like ad.ethoseo.com.
